The Hyper 212 Black Edition is the default recommendation when someone asks about a budget cooler, and it earns that reputation with a clean matte finish and real-world performance. The single 120mm fan and 4 direct-contact heatpipes keep mid-range CPUs like the Ryzen 5 7600X or Core i5-13600K at 75-80C under sustained load. Not record-breaking, but perfectly safe. The AM5 and LGA1700 mounting brackets are included, and installation takes about 15 minutes. If you are not overclocking aggressively, this is all the cooler you need.

The Dark Rock Pro 4 is built for people who need silence more than bragging rights. The asymmetric dual-tower design clears RAM with the front tower while the rear tower does the heavy lifting. Two Silent Wings 135mm fans operate so quietly you will have to check that they are spinning. Thermal performance is competitive with the NH-D15 within a degree or two, and the all-black aesthetic integrates cleanly in any build. The downside is price -- you are paying a premium for acoustics. If noise matters, that premium is worth every cent.

The Kraken 240 is NZXT's mid-range AIO and hits the sweet spot of price, performance, and aesthetics. The 240mm radiator with two 120mm F Series fans provides cooling that comfortably beats any air cooler under 100mm tall. The LCD display on the pump head shows CPU temp, fan speed, or custom graphics -- genuinely useful, not just flashy. NZXT CAM software is required for full control but has improved significantly over earlier versions. Ideal for mid-towers where a 360mm rad will not fit but you still want serious thermal headroom for Ryzen 7 builds.

The H150i Elite is Corsair's flagship 360mm AIO and it shows -- three 120mm AF Elite fans move serious air through a thick aluminum radiator. On a Core i9-13900K, expect sustained temps in the mid-70s under full all-core load, outperforming most 280mm AIOs. The Capellix LED pump head is bright and responsive in iCUE. The software ecosystem is Corsair's biggest strength and weakness: deep customization but another background process to manage. Best for enthusiast builds running high-TDP processors where you want real overclocking headroom.
